C语言实现:1000以内水仙花数查找详解

创始人
2025-03-24 23:11:23
0 次浏览
0 评论

C语言求1000以内的水仙花数?

在C语言中,水仙花数字是指某些数字,每位N的总数与自身的总数相等。
在1 000之内,我们想找到三个数字的水仙花。
以下是C语言程序的一个示例,该程序在1 000范围内找到了所有的水仙花:``c#income intmain(){intt,h,t,a; for(i = 1 00; i <1 xss=clean xss=clean> 接下来,三个数字的总计算代码,并将它们与原始数字进行比较``i',如果等于,则输出是因为它是raffodil号码。
请注意,该代码必须包括``````````要关闭主函数和变量a`,`b` b`,`g` g'和s`不需要将其定义为整数,只需使用``int''即可。
此外,实际上,我们应该遵循一个良好的编程习惯,并适当命名以提高代码的阅读功能。
可以在1 000范围内以及通过清晰的片段和逻辑结构(易于理解和维护代码)中找到上述代码。

c语言中定义一个a[1000]的数组,向这个数组中输入1000个数,怎么编程输出1000个数中数值

#include int main(){int a [1 000],min,i;

编程打印出100到1000所有的水仙花数

Jonquille编号是指该数字的总和等于数字本身的三位数。
例如,1 5 3 是一个jonquille号码,因为1

3

+5 3

+3 3 = 1 5 3 通过编程,我们可以找到1 00和1 000之间的所有jonquilles。
z,num; printf(“ narcissus a:\ n”); for(num = 1 00; * x + y * y * y + z * z * z))printf(“%d \ t”,num);}}该程序首先定义四个全变量x,y,z和num。
其中,X,Y和Z分别偷走了数百个,数字中有十个和独特的数字。
变量NUM用于浏览1 00到1 000之间的所有数字。
该程序通过循环以循环的循环跨越此范围的所有数字。
对于每个数字,该程序首先计算其数百,十和唯一数字,然后检查数字是否等于其单个数字的立方体之和。
如果是相等的,则数量已输出。
最后,该程序将打印所有下颌编号在1 00到1 000之间。
执行上面的程序,您可以获得1 00到1 000之间的所有下颌编号,即1 5 3 、3 7 0、3 7 1 、4 07 杂耍号码的名称来自一个传说,即数学家在他梦中获得了一个神秘的数字。
这个传奇引起了数学界的极大关注。
在数学中,杆的数量是一个特殊的数字。
他们还遵循了一个法律,即每个数字的高幂等于数字本身。
通过编程找到数量的Jonquilles不仅可以锻炼编程技能,而且可以加深您对数量数量的理解。
对杆数量的研究不仅可以帮助我们了解数字的奇观,还可以激发我们对数学的兴趣。

C语言求1000以内的水仙花数怎么写代码?

要在1 000 C语言中找到水仙花的数量,您可以将其用于循环。
您可以参考以下代码:#include main(){int i = 0,g,s,b,a = 0; for(i = 0; i <1> = 1 00 && i <= 9 9 9 ){b = i/1 00;   s =(i-b*1 00)/1 0; //现有1 0 g = i-b*1 00-S*1 0;   a = b*b*b+s*s+g*g*g;  } if(a == i)printf(“%d \ n”,a);  }}高级信息:对于循环语法1 语句的最简单形式是:for(;;)2 一般形式是:for(一次性表达式;条件表达式;最终循环主体){中间循环主体;}之间,可以留下表达式,但可以留下昏迷,但是昏迷不能留下,因为“”; 可以表示空白语句。
在没有消除后,陈述减少了,即说明格式的更改,编译器无法识别它,也无法安排。
参考资料来源:百度百科全书 - 循环
热门文章
1
高效掌握:CMD命令轻松启动、关闭及登录... 如何用cmd命令快速启动和关闭mysql数据库服务开发中经常使用MySQL数据库...

2
MySQL分区删除技巧与8.0版本新特性... mysql删除分区在MySQL中,删除分区操作主要使用“可替代”的命令与“ dr...

3
Python代码实现:如何判断三角形的三... python三角形三条边长,判断能否构成三角形Python三角形的三个长边如下:...

4
深度解析:MySQL查询语句执行顺序及优... mysql查询语句执行顺序当这是由于执行SQL的过程时,了解其过程很重要。 ...

5
SQL教程:使用SUBSTRING和IN... sql取特定字符的前面几位字符selectsubstr('L-0FCLDRBCT...

6
MySQL日期差异计算方法:轻松获取日期... MySQL计算时间差两日期相减得月份mysql两时间相减得月MySQL计算时间之...

7
MySQL及SQL查询获取前10条数据方... MySql查询前10条数据sql语句是从MySQL获取前1 0个数据的SQL查询...

8
MySQL启动问题排查与解决指南 Mysql为什么启动不了如果要配置MySQL,则遇到无法启动的问题,可能是由于配...

9
DbVisualizer添加MySQL数... 如何在DbVisualizer中添加本地mysql数据库由于DbVisualiz...

10
SQL字段默认值设置全攻略:轻松实现自动... sql如何设置字段默认值设置SQL中某个字段的默认值;需要遵循几个步骤。首先您需...